Making Sure We’re Taken Care of From Head to Toe 

 

Six years ago, Tywana Smith was simply looking for a place in suburban Cincinnati to purchase products to use on her children’s hair. Unable to find what she was looking for she naturally turned to the web - first as a customer, then as a merchant. “We realized that there had to be other people who were in areas like this and couldn’t get their products,” Smith said.

 

Of course there were, so she and her husband, Brian, started doing research on the types and brands of products that people in similar situations might use and came up with a lot of the products they have for purchase on their Web site, TreasuredLocks.com.

 

For the past few years, more and more people have started to wear their hair in natural styles. From locs to kinky twists to the classic afro, people of color all over the country have started to move away from the chemical treatments that often do more harm than good. A lot of the products that people of color are used to using have a lot of chemicals that are not intended for their use, she said. “There’s not enough moisture and [the products] are very drying,” explains Smith.

That is because a lot of these products contain a lot of alcohol and act as an astringent for the scalp, drawing moisture out when it should be retaining it. Now that so many people are becoming more conscious of their cosmetic products, Smith’s site serves as a marketplace for all natural hair and skin products. “I think a lot more people are looking for more quality products,” Smith shares.

 

Tywana and Brian’s commitment to offering quality products to people of the diaspora is so strong that in addition to selling items made by Black Earth, SheaMoisture and Baka, they have a series of products that they offer under the names, Treasured Locks, Ajuven and HumiNature. The products include a hair growth serum, a hair and scalp elixr, herbal hair balm, conditioners, pomade, gel, body butters and oils.

 

In addition to products, TreasureLocks.com has leaped into the blogosphere and also offers a wealth of information on hair and skin care including tips on starting and maintaining hairstyles and a natural hair salon listing. “It’s really an honor for us to be able to offer this service,” Smith said. “The part I love about it is being able to talk to the different people on the blog and the message boards. It’s fulfilling to be able to help people.”
